U.S. Rep. Jim Oberstar, D-Minn., will hold at news conference today to comment on the Northwest-Delta airlines merger announced Monday evening.
Oberstar, the chairman of the House Transportation and Infrastructure Committee, opposes the merger.
"I'm concerned about the effect this merger could have on the aviation industry; it will trigger a cascade of mergers," Oberstar said in a news release this morning. "You will wind up with three mega, global air carriers. And then what voice does an air traveler in International Falls or Minot, North Dakota have? None."
Rep. Jerry F. Costello, D-Ill., chairman of the Subcommittee on Aviation, will also talk during the conference.
The news conference begins at 1:45 p.m. Central Daylight Time from the Rayburn House Office Building in Washington, D.C.
